What is Moringa Powder?

Moringa powder is derived from the leaves of the Moringa oleifera tree, commonly known as the "drumstick tree" or the "miracle tree." This tree is native to regions of Africa and Asia and has garnered attention globally for its remarkable nutritional benefits. The leaves of the moringa tree are harvested, dried, and ground into a fine powder, creating a versatile superfood that can be incorporated into a variety of dishes and beverages.

Rich in nutrients, moringa powder boasts an impressive nutritional profile. It contains essential vitamins such as A, C, and E, which are crucial for maintaining healthy skin, immune function, and overall vitality. Additionally, it is an excellent source of minerals, including calcium, potassium, and iron, contributing to bone health, muscle function, and oxygen transport within the body. Furthermore, moringa powder is packed with antioxidants, which play a vital role in combating oxidative stress, thereby promoting better health and wellbeing.

Historically, moringa has been utilized in traditional medicine across various cultures. In Ayurvedic practices, moringa is revered for its numerous healing properties and has been traditionally used to treat ailments ranging from inflammation to digestive issues. In African cultures, different parts of the moringa tree, including its leaves, pods, and seeds, have been utilized for nutritional and medicinal purposes for centuries. The traditional use of moringa reinforces its significance as a health-enhancing food and underscores its potential benefits in a modern dietary context.

Health Benefits of Moringa Powder

Moringa powder, derived from the leaves of the Moringa oleifera tree, is increasingly recognized for its extensive health benefits. Rich in nutrients, it possesses anti-inflammatory properties, making it effective in reducing inflammation in the body. Research has shown that compounds found in moringa, such as quercetin and chlorogenic acid, can significantly lower inflammation markers, which are pivotal in preventing chronic diseases such as arthritis and heart disease.

One of the most studied benefits of moringa powder is its potential to lower blood sugar levels. Various studies have indicated that the consumption of moringa can help regulate insulin levels and improve overall blood sugar management. This attribute is especially beneficial for individuals with diabetes or those at risk of developing this condition. The bioactive compounds in moringa contribute to its hypoglycemic effects, making it a valuable addition to a diabetes-friendly diet.

In addition to its blood-sugar-lowering effects, moringa powder is known for boosting energy levels. The nutritional profile of moringa is impressive, containing essential vitamins and minerals that support energy metabolism. By incorporating moringa powder into one’s diet, individuals may experience increased stamina and reduced fatigue, which can enhance overall productivity and well-being.

Another significant benefit of moringa powder is its role in improving digestion. Moringa is rich in dietary fiber, which aids in maintaining a healthy digestive tract and preventing issues such as constipation. Its high antioxidant content also contributes to gut health by combating oxidative stress, promoting a balanced digestive system.

Moreover, moringa powder supports immune function due to its rich content of vitamins A, C, and E. These vitamins are known for their role in enhancing the immune response, helping the body fend off infections and illnesses. Regular consumption of moringa can thus play a vital role in bolstering one’s health and preventing diseases.

How to Incorporate Moringa Powder into Your Diet

Integrating moringa powder into your daily diet can be both simple and enjoyable, allowing you to harness its numerous health benefits seamlessly. Moringa powder, derived from the leaves of the Moringa oleifera tree, is rich in essential nutrients, making it a valuable addition to various meals.

A popular method of consumption is through smoothies. By blending one to two teaspoons of moringa powder into your morning smoothie, you can effortlessly enhance its nutritional profile. Combine it with fruits like bananas, spinach, or berries, and a plant-based milk such as almond or coconut for a refreshing start to your day. Alternatively, moringa can be added to juices. Simply mix it into a citrus-based juice for a zesty and nutritious drink that can energize you throughout the morning.

For those who enjoy cooking, moringa powder is a versatile ingredient that can be incorporated into soups, stews, and sauces. When simmering vegetable soup, consider adding moringa powder in the last few minutes of cooking to preserve its nutrients while imparting a subtle earthy flavor. Similarly, you might stir it into pasta sauces or grain dishes like quinoa or brown rice, enhancing their health benefits.

Baking enthusiasts can also explore the use of moringa powder. It can be added to muffin or pancake batters, giving baked goods a nutritious twist without compromising taste. Start with one tablespoon of moringa powder to your favorite recipe and adjust according to your preference.

When incorporating moringa powder into your diet, it’s essential to consider dosage. Most experts recommend beginning with a small amount—one teaspoon daily—and gradually increasing it to two or three teaspoons as your body adjusts. Pairing moringa with foods rich in vitamin C, such as citrus fruits or bell peppers, may enhance nutrient absorption. Potential Side Effects and Precautions

Moringa powder has garnered significant attention for its numerous health benefits, but it is also essential to be aware of its potential side effects and the necessary precautions for safe consumption. Although moringa is generally recognized as safe, some individuals may experience allergic reactions, which can manifest as rashes or gastrointestinal discomfort. Those with known allergies to plants in the Moringaceae family, such as horse radish tree or drumstick tree, should exercise discretion and consult a healthcare professional before incorporating moringa powder into their diet.

Furthermore, moringa may interact with certain medications, particularly those that manage blood sugar levels or anticoagulants. Its ability to lower blood sugar might amplify the effects of diabetes medications, necessitating a careful adjustment of dosages under medical supervision. Similarly, individuals on blood-thinning medications should consult healthcare providers, as moringa may affect blood clotting. It is advisable for all individuals, especially those with pre-existing health conditions or on multiple medications, to discuss the use of moringa powder with a qualified healthcare professional.

Regarding intake levels, moderation is key. Most recommendations suggest starting with a small dosage, such as half a teaspoon, and gradually increasing it to one to two teaspoons per day. This gradual approach allows the body to acclimate while minimizing the risk of any adverse effects. Additionally, pregnant or breastfeeding women should exercise caution as limited research exists regarding the safety of moringa during these periods. It is crucial that such individuals consult with their healthcare providers before adding moringa powder to their diet, ensuring a balanced approach to health and nutrition.
